Known Issue
If on Cisco IOS unter the router ospfv3 process the address-family ipv4 configured then the snmp access needs to be in a seperate snmp context :-( .
NOTE: There is no still no access to IPv4 data, also not to data from VRFs :-(
######################################################################################
router ospfv3 10
!
address-family ipv4 unicast
router-id 1.1.1.30
snmp context IPv4
exit-address-family
!
address-family ipv6 unicast
router-id 1.1.1.30
snmp context IPv6
exit-address-family
!
snmp-server context IPV6
snmp-server group IPV6 v3 priv context IPV6
snmp-server user IPV6 IPV6 v3 auth sha authtpw priv aes 128 privpw
snmp-server context IPV4
snmp-server group IPV4 v3 priv context IPV6
snmp-server user IPV4 IPV4 v3 auth sha authtpw priv aes 128 privpw
!
